You should posts your question in the close-up sections talking about the device. As it is sold as close-up trick with very casual clothing. I have only seen as you this is used for a half dollar or dollar size coins.

If you do not get a response, may I suggest contacting Michael Ammar, as he is one of the promoters for this device (if I remember correctly). He does close-up and stage magic, and will be able to answer your question with all his knowledge. He will also better understand under what conditions you are speaking about concerning your clothing issue and how it may or may not interfere with you other tricks.

From the strings on this in Latest and Greatest and the new tricks section, I believe if you wear a tie, it would get in the way of the device working.

If you cannot get an answer, consider using a Michael Ammar Topit with the retrievable feature from the pocket. Pat Page talked about being able to retrieve objects directly form the bottom of a Topit.

Depending on where you get the coin from, you can also consider using the pendulum principle as mentioned by Tommy Wonder in his books. Topas uses it in his act for the production and vanish or a jumbo bell. So a coin jumbo coin should work. Again, it depends on your clothing and how you wear them.

Quote:
On 2013-03-31 18:01, dahih beik wrote:
I need advice and help , anyone use or have experience with tko2 , is it like a shirt topit , would it wprk if you have a jaket as well, could it be applied into manipulation vanishes , like vanishing a coin or a jumbo coin ??? your help is appreciatted .


Hi,

I think I can answer your questions. I have the TKO 2.0. You can use it with a jacket on but a tie could get in the way. It is best used for vanishing small coins or similar-sized flat objects. If you want to vanish a jumbo coin or big bulky objects, a topit would be better.

"is it like a shirt topit"
Simple answer: no.
Complex answer: It could be used for ditching and producing some objects, but not in exactly the same manner as a topit.

"would it work if you have a jacket"
Yes

"could it be applied into manipulation vanishes"
Yes, but not like a topit.

"vanishing a coin or a jumbo coin"
Yes, but again, not exactly like a topit.

I think this would be a good tool for a stage or close up magician to have. It can be put to many many different uses and can clean up different aspects of your magic.
